Output 7bd7cdcc679c3226f270749c15ededbd51520a9749dc47e725e4b4818fb476f3:3

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e366e3f8203ff3b7a7048e0a61d5b7a929b16f02 OP_EQUAL
address
3NRQa3fuk1L8txEnqssvoW5tbqz3tK2pqX
transaction
7bd7cdcc679c3226f270749c15ededbd51520a9749dc47e725e4b4818fb476f3